Upper Mississippi River NWR - Genoa National Fish Hatchery

https://ebird.org/wi/hotspot/L755216

Habitat: Bottomland Hardwoods, Marsh, Open Water, Mudflats.

Best Birds: The large marsh at the east end of the property attracts herons, egrets, and both migrant and breeding waterfowl.  Search for shorebirds on the mudflats and drained ponds.  The bottomland forest provides habitat for Red-shouldered Hawk, Pileated Woodpecker, and Prothonotary Warbler

Directions:  19 miles S of LaCrosse. The Interpretive Center (43.523249, -91.215182) is 3 miles south of Genoa on State Highway 35.  The auto tour goes both east and west of the state highway.  Just south of the STH 35 Bridge over the Bad Axe River is a lane leading to a boat landing on the Mississippi River.  Mundsack Road to Willenberg Road to Heck’s Road is a nice loop around the Hatchery property.
